Lawyer Didn't Believe His Innocence Says Frye
Published September 13th, 2012
OCALA - He insists he is an innocent man, but a jury found him guilty.
On Aug. 22n Michael Alan Frye was convicted of kidnapping and three counts of sexual battery, but he is appealing the case.
In an exclusive jailhouse interview, he told us what was going through his mind the moment the verdict was read.
"I knew I was going to be found guilty. I knew for a fact I was," said Frye.
"Why?"
"Because the way my lawyer did the closing arguments. I just knew it," said Frye.
Nearly three weeks after his conviction, Frye openened up to TV20, telling us he feels his lawyer did a poor job representing him in court.
"If I put myself in that jury and the way he said it made it sound like he had doubt," said Frye.
Doubt about whether or not Frye committed a violent crime: kidnapping, beating and raping a women in the woods.
"I take the blame for some of it," he said.
He acknowledges to us that he picked up the woman, but evidence shown in court proves otherwise.
"So your saying you weren't with any prostitutes last Wednesday?"
"No," said Frye.
"You don't think it's better just to tell the truth?"
"At that point when they really really started coming down I knew no matter what I would say it really doesn't matter," said Frye.
He describes his recent trial as unfair.
"How in the world can she testify and they allow her to testify, when they did her deposition the day they are picking the jury?" Frye said. "How can he properly represent me when they are doing it the same day."
His lawyer Jack Nugent said Frye is mistaken because the victim's deposition was taken on March 6.
However, what Frye says his biggest issue with his lawyer is that he says he didn't believe in Frye's innocence.
Frye faces multiple rape trials . Jury selection for his next trial is set for October 8.
